Transaction 077f885d47fcc96e178ee86d2f587801d61814bbf95a330d3e33b3ee250bb81c
1 Input
2 Outputs
- 077f885d47fcc96e178ee86d2f587801d61814bbf95a330d3e33b3ee250bb81c:0
- 077f885d47fcc96e178ee86d2f587801d61814bbf95a330d3e33b3ee250bb81c:1
value 2262766
address 14EebqAWP8xpDjNHiW7SNLwiXa62JMczmP
value 51015861
address 12Q4VsuFS21CxEKS8DjG8HSDzcHPxCn4mW